Description
This Request for Proposal (RFP) seeks a qualified proponent to conduct a municipal-wide whistle cessation study and develop related policies for the Municipality of Clarington. The project includes assessing implementation, operating, maintenance, and lifecycle implications of whistle cessation requests, developing a policy and process framework, reviewing current crossings, establishing prioritization, evaluating noise mitigation alternatives, and considering performance data from specific rail crossings. The work supports the municipality in managing future whistle cessation requests effectively.
